Directions
1.
Cook spinach, onion and garlic according to spinach package directions. In colander drain well, using back of spoon to press out excess moisture.
2.
In medium bowl stir together egg yolk, feta cheese, Parmesan cheese, oregano and spinach mixture. Shape into twently 1/2-inch thick patties.
3.
Finely crush crackers. In shallow dish place flour. In another shallow dish stir together 1 egg and milk. In third shallow dish place cracker crumbs. Dip spinach patties in flour, shaking off excess. Dip into egg mixture, then into crumbs.
4.
In large skillet cook patties in hot oil over medium heat for 4 to 5 minutes or until golden brown, turning once. Serve immediately.

NOTE:
Patties may be kept warm at 250 degrees F for up to 30 minutes.
